
Lychee Custard

You can also add some vanilla paste to your custard for extra flavor!
Add 250 g of deseeded lychees to a blender jug. Blend on medium speed to form a chunky paste
Sieve the paste to separate the juice from the pulp
Transfer the lychee juice to a pot and reserve the pulp
Add 150 g of milk and 2 egg yolks
Add 44 g of sugar and 14 g of cornstarch
Whisk the mixture until homogeneous
Cook the mixture over medium low heat, whisking constantly until it thickens
Remove from the heat and add 14 g of butter. Whisk to combine
Add the lychee flesh and whisk to combine. Let it cool down completely. The lychee custard is ready
Enjoy adding it to various desserts!
Yield 450 g
